Essential Ingredients You’ll Need

To create these Churro Cheesecake Bars, you’ll need a handful of key ingredients that work in harmony to deliver that rich, sweet flavor.

2 cups graham cracker crumbs
The base of our bars, graham cracker crumbs provide a sweet, buttery flavor and a crumbly texture that holds everything together perfectly.

1/2 cup unsalted butter, melted
Melted butter is essential for binding the graham cracker crumbs into a crust while adding richness and moisture.

1/4 cup granulated sugar
This sugar sweetens the crust just enough to complement the creamy filling while also enhancing the overall dessert flavor.

2 (8 oz) packages cream cheese, softened
Cream cheese is the star of the show here! It gives the bars their creamy texture and rich flavor, making them irresistibly smooth.

1 cup powdered sugar
Powdered sugar helps sweeten the cheesecake filling without adding grittiness, ensuring a silky-smooth consistency.

1 teaspoon vanilla extract
Vanilla extract brings depth and warmth to the cheesecake filling, enhancing its flavor profile.

2 large eggs
Eggs are crucial for setting the cheesecake, giving it structure and stability once it’s baked.

1 tablespoon ground cinnamon
Cinnamon adds that quintessential churro flavor, making these bars feel indulgent and comforting.

1/4 cup granulated sugar (for topping)
This sugar is mixed with cinnamon to create the final touch that gives the bars their churro-like sweetness and crunch on top.

1/2 cup caramel sauce (optional)
While optional, caramel sauce offers an extra layer of decadence, creating a delightful contrast with the creamy filling and crunchy topping.

Step-by-Step Churro Cheesecake Bars Instructions

Preparing Your Churro Cheesecake Bars

Making these Churro Cheesecake Bars is a breeze! With just 15 minutes of prep time and 30 minutes of cook time, you’ll have a delicious treat ready in 45 minutes. Before you start, gather your equipment: a 9×13 inch baking dish, mixing bowls, an electric mixer, and measuring cups.

1- Preheat your oven to 325°F (163°C). As the oven heats up, prepare your baking dish by greasing it lightly with cooking spray or lining it with parchment paper. This will help the bars come out easily once they’re baked.

2- In a large mixing bowl, combine the graham cracker crumbs, melted butter, and 1/4 cup granulated sugar. Mix well until the crumbs are fully coated with butter. The mixture should resemble wet sand. Press this mixture firmly into the bottom of your prepared baking dish, creating an even layer. Use the back of a measuring cup to pack it down tightly for a sturdy crust.

3- In another bowl, beat the softened cream cheese with an electric mixer on medium speed until smooth and creamy, about 2-3 minutes. Make sure there are no lumps. Gradually add in the powdered sugar and mix until well combined. Scrape down the sides of the bowl as needed to ensure everything is mixed evenly.

4- Next, add in the vanilla extract and eggs, one at a time, mixing well after each addition. Be careful not to overmix; you just want everything to be well incorporated. The filling should be smooth and slightly thick—this is what will create that velvety cheesecake texture.

5- Pour the cream cheese filling over the prepared crust, spreading it evenly with a spatula. Tap the baking dish gently on the counter to remove any air bubbles. Bake in the preheated oven for 30 minutes. You’ll know it’s done when the edges are set, and the center is slightly jiggly but not liquid.

6- While the cheesecake bars are baking, combine the ground cinnamon and 1/4 cup granulated sugar in a small bowl. As soon as you take the bars out of the oven, sprinkle this cinnamon-sugar mixture generously over the top. Allow the bars to cool completely in the baking dish before slicing them into squares. For a special touch, drizzle caramel sauce over the bars just before serving.

Pro Tips for Success

To ensure your Churro Cheesecake Bars turn out perfectly, here are some expert tips:

1- Use room temperature cream cheese. This helps achieve a smooth filling without lumps. If your cream cheese is too cold, it can create a clumpy texture.

2- Don’t overbake! Keep an eye on your bars; overbaking can lead to a dry cheesecake. The center should still have a slight jiggle when you take them out.

3- Allow them to cool completely before slicing. This ensures clean cuts and helps the bars set up properly.

4- For a cleaner slice, use a sharp knife dipped in warm water. Wipe the knife clean between cuts for perfectly shaped bars.

Storage and Make-Ahead Tips

Storing your Churro Cheesecake Bars is easy! Once they’ve cooled completely, cover them tightly with plastic wrap or transfer them to an airtight container. They can be kept in the refrigerator for up to 5 days, making them a great make-ahead dessert for any occasion.

If you want to keep them longer, you can freeze the bars. Simply wrap them individually in plastic wrap and place them in a freezer-safe container. They’ll last up to 3 months in the freezer. When you’re ready to enjoy, let them thaw in the refrigerator overnight before serving. To reheat, pop them in the microwave for about 15-20 seconds for a warm treat.

Variations and Dietary Adaptations for Churro Cheesecake Bars

Creative Churro Cheesecake Bars Variations

While the classic Churro Cheesecake Bars are phenomenal, don’t hesitate to mix things up! Here are a few variations to consider:

1- Chocolate Churro Cheesecake Bars: Add melted chocolate to the cream cheese filling for a rich chocolate twist. Swirl it in for a marbled effect before baking.

2- Pumpkin Churro Cheesecake Bars: Substitute half of the cream cheese with pumpkin puree and add spices like nutmeg and ginger for a fall-inspired treat.

3- Nutty Churro Cheesecake Bars: Fold in crushed nuts, such as pecans or walnuts, into the cheesecake filling for added texture and flavor.

4- Fruit-Topped Churro Cheesecake Bars: Top with fresh fruits or a fruit compote to add a burst of freshness and color to the bars.

Making Churro Cheesecake Bars Diet-Friendly

If you’re looking to make these Churro Cheesecake Bars more accommodating for dietary restrictions, here are some suggestions:

1- Gluten-Free: Use gluten-free graham cracker crumbs or an alternative crust made from ground almonds or oats to create a gluten-free version.

2- Vegan: Substitute the cream cheese with a vegan cream cheese alternative and use flax eggs instead of regular eggs. For the crust, use vegan butter.

3- Low-Carb: Swap out the graham cracker crumbs for almond flour and use a sugar substitute in place of granulated and powdered sugar to create a low-carb version.

4- Dairy-Free: Use coconut cream in place of cream cheese and a dairy-free butter alternative for the crust to make these bars dairy-free.

Q: What should I do if my cheesecake bars crack?
A: Cracks can occur due to overbaking or rapid temperature changes. Be sure to bake at the recommended temperature and let them cool gradually to prevent cracks.
